Ferredoxin is an iron-sulfur protein that effects electron transfer in a large number of redox reactions in cell metabolism through Fe-S clusters whose iron cations oscillate between +2 (ferrous) oxidation states. and +3 (ferric). The first protein of this type was isolated in 1962 from the anaerobic bacterium Clostridium pasteurianum. A chloroplast-specific ferredoxin is involved in the cyclic and noncyclic photophosphorylation reactions of photosynthesis. In non-cyclic photophosphorylation, ferredoxin is the ultimate electron acceptor and reduces NADP + under the action of ferredoxin-NADP + reductase (EC 1.18.1.2) with FAD and a flavin group as cofactors:
2 ferredoxin- [Fe (2+) Fe (3+) S2 (-2)] + NADP (+) + H (+) ==> 2 ferredoxin- [Fe3 (+2) S2 (-2)] + NADPH .

<u>Acceptable Macronutrient Distribution Range:</u>
Acceptable Macronutrient Distribution Range is the predetermined range of intake for a particular energy source in our diet that is associated with overall health and reduce the risk of chronic disease with the aim of making the intake supply essential nutrients which are important in metabolism, growth, and many other functions. If an individual consumed in excess of Acceptable Macronutrient Distribution Ranges, it raises concerns over a potential increase in the risk of chronic diseases.
